Summary

Today’s word of the day is ‘2.2 seconds’ as in Winnipeg Jets as in NHL as in hockey as in Game 7 as in madness. What did we just see? The Jets came back from a 2-goal deficit with 1:55 left. Wow. And then win it in 2OT!? Sorry, St. Louis. What could have been! (7:30) Another Game 7 happened but in the NBA. The Warriors did it on the road. Wow. Steph Curry had a huge 4th quarter. Buddy Hield had the game of his life. (15:30) We talked recently about adding another bag at first base will not happen, but should it? Triston Casas is the latest player to be done for the season after suffering a serious injury running to first. (24:10) So You Wanna Talk to Samson!? Someone asked me about contraction in MLB. What would need to happen for MLB to consider the Rockies or Marlins or Pirates as possible teams to go away? (33:34) Review: Good Night and Good Luck. (42:30) Gregg Popovich is headed to the front office. He was named the preisdent of the Spurs. Sad end to his coaching career, but needed move. The best to ever do it.
